J. Vair Jewellers is seeking a highly organized and detail-oriented Inventory and Service Manager to oversee inventory management and client service operations in our luxury jewellery store. This role requires exceptional organizational skills, strong attention to detail, and a commitment to maintaining the highest standards in luxury retail.
Key Responsibilities:
Inventory Management:
- Oversee and manage all aspects of inventory control, including receiving, storing, transferring, and monitoring luxury jewellery and watches.
- Process current inventory upon arrival, accurately describing all product features.
- Conduct regular inventory audits and reconcile discrepancies promptly and accurately.
- Maintain detailed records and documentation to ensure accurate stock levels and efficient stock replenishment.
Service Operations:
- Coordinate and manage jewellery and watch repair services, ensuring timely completion and exceptional quality standards.
- Correspond with watch brand service centres regarding client services and repair requirements.
- Assist in managing the workload of our in-house watch repair workshop, ensuring accurate recording of all parts and services.
- Obtain service estimates for clients and provide detailed information regarding their service needs.
Shipping and Receiving:
- Manage incoming and outgoing shipments, ensuring timely dispatch while adhering strictly to customs and shipment declaration regulations.
- Responsible for ensuring all items and service jobs are shipped promptly and accurately.
Team Leadership and Collaboration:
- Collaborate closely with sales and store management teams to streamline inventory and service-related processes.
- Train and guide staff on inventory procedures, handling protocols, and service standards.
Quality Assurance and Compliance:
- Ensure adherence to all company policies, procedures, and industry standards related to inventory management and service quality.
- Continuously evaluate and improve inventory and service processes to enhance operational efficiency.
Qualifications:
- Previous experience in inventory management or service operations, ideally within luxury retail.
- Strong analytical, organizational, and problem-solving skills.
- Excellent verbal and written communication abilities.
- Proficiency in inventory management software and systems.
- A commitment to delivering outstanding client service and maintaining high standards.
- Passion for Luxury timepieces
